Situated on the outskirts of Longframlington, in the Northumberland countryside, is this charming cabin, Glandon.
The property is set in a peaceful and tranquil location for couples seeking a romantic escape to Northumberland.
Be welcomed into an open-plan living room where you can look forward to relaxing and unwinding in front of the TV.
The compact kitchen has all the necessary appliances for cooking up some delicious meals to enjoy after a long day.
Choose to rest your head in the double bedroom, most suitable for couples, with sharing a shower room.
To the front of the cabin is a small garden area where you can sit out in the afternoon sun with a refreshing drink, or dine alfresco.
Travel into the centre of Longframlington village for accessing two delightful pubs which serve fine food if you don't fancy cooking one evening.
Make sure you travel towards the bustling market town of Alnwick which is rich with popular tourist attractions that are a must-see during your next visit to Northumberland.
For a spot of history, visit the medieval Alnwick Castle and its complex gardens surrounding it for a spot of history and beauty as you explore the grounds.
You are also within driving distance of the stunning coastline for long walks or cycling.
There are a number of sandy beaches within reach where you can enjoy a picnic on the golden sands and get involved with a variety of watersporting opportunities.
Keen explorers will delight in visiting the Northumberland National Park for walking, cycling and hiking, with stunning views to see along the way.
Glandon is an excellent choice for couples seeking a romantic break.
